Submit one original poem to any Jefferson-Madison Regional Library (JMRL) location, WriterHouse*, or via our online entry form for a chance to win prizes and glory.
- Entries are due Oct. 16, 2023 by 5 p.m. for poets age 18 and above.
- The theme this year is The Importance of Community.
- One 30-line or less poem may be submitted by each contestant.
- Prizes: $200 Visa gift card for the winner and $100 Visa gift card for the runner-up.
- UVA English Professor Debra Nystrom will judge finalists (a panel of judges will review the entries).
